HB 1714 District court or circuit court clerk; records sent to DMV.

Introduced by: S. R. Iaquinto-resigned 7/1/13 | all patrons    ...    notes | add to my profiles

S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:

Records sent to the Department of Motor Vehicles; court clerks. Clarifies the timing for when a clerk of a district court or circuit court is required to forward an abstract of the record in certain cases to the Commissioner of the Department of Motor Vehicles. The bill further provides that if the records in the office of any district court or circuit court clerk show that the judgment in such cases has been vacated or nullified in any manner, the clerk shall make a report of such to the Commissioner. The bill provides further that no record in the district court should be filed unless the time for filing an appeal has expired and no appeal has been perfected.
